Top Cordless Handheld Paint Sprayers for Home Projects

Cordless handheld paint sprayers have become a popular choice for home projects because they offer portability and ease of use without sacrificing performance. When selecting a model, consider battery life; a longer-lasting battery keeps you working without interruptions. Look for sprayers with sufficient nozzle size to handle your project’s scope—larger nozzles are ideal for broad surfaces, while smaller ones work better for detail work. A good cordless sprayer should have a battery that charges quickly and maintains power throughout your task. The nozzle size affects paint flow and finish quality, so choose accordingly. Compact models with adjustable nozzle options give you flexibility for different surfaces. With the right balance of battery life and nozzle size, you’ll complete your home projects efficiently and with professional-looking results. How Long Does a Typical Battery Last on Cordless Paint Sprayers?
You might wonder how long a typical battery lasts on cordless paint sprayers. Battery life generally ranges from 20 to 60 minutes, depending on the sprayer’s capacity and usage. Keep in mind, higher spray intensity can drain the battery faster. For maximum sprayer durability, choose models with long-lasting batteries and consider carrying spare ones. This way, you can complete your project without interruptions and ensure consistent performance.

Are There Specific Paints Compatible With Handheld Sprayers?
When considering paint compatibility for handheld sprayers, you need to choose the right type of paint that flows smoothly and doesn’t clog the device. Thinned latex and acrylic paints are usually compatible, but thicker paints may require thinning or specific sprayer techniques. Always check the manufacturer’s recommendations for your sprayer to guarantee the best performance and a professional finish. Do Electric Models Produce More Overspray Than Manual Methods?
When comparing overspray between manual and electric models, electric sprayers tend to produce more overspray. This overspray comparison happens because electric models often have higher pressure and faster spray rates, making control trickier. You might find manual methods give you better precision with less overspray. So, if minimizing overspray is your priority, manual techniques could be more effective, while electric sprayers are faster but require careful control to reduce excess paint.
